Output c0fc200b732c4dc082f39e24960a24c88899640190697de5a55ae2a36933120c:2

value
17488051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0743171d3b62e09c9f21dc117eb617cb50b4af8f OP_EQUAL
address
M8ZZLHfHBCYbURsX5KdfjBNiaTcB1FcKhY
transaction
c0fc200b732c4dc082f39e24960a24c88899640190697de5a55ae2a36933120c
spent
true